diff options
Diffstat (limited to 'src/sh_filter.c')
-rw-r--r-- | src/sh_filter.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/sh_filter.c b/src/sh_filter.c index 4cd9578..aa9c471 100644 --- a/src/sh_filter.c +++ b/src/sh_filter.c @@ -114,6 +114,7 @@ int sh_filter_add (const char * str, sh_filter_type * filter, int type) SL_RETURN((-1), _("sh_filter_filteradd")); } + /* cppcheck-suppress uninitvar */ i = *ntok; if (i == SH_FILT_NUM) { SL_RETURN((-1), _("sh_filter_filteradd")); @@ -292,7 +293,7 @@ sh_filter_type * sh_filter_alloc(void) { sh_filter_type * filter = SH_ALLOC(sizeof(sh_filter_type)); - memset(filter, '\0', sizeof(sh_filter_type)); + memset(filter, 0, sizeof(sh_filter_type)); filter->for_c = 0; filter->fand_c = 0; filter->fnot_c = 0; |